Adriana Barylyak is a scholar working on Biomedical Engineering, Renewable Energy, Sustainability and the Environment and Materials Chemistry. According to data from OpenAlex, Adriana Barylyak has authored 21 papers receiving a total of 362 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Biomedical Engineering, 5 papers in Renewable Energy, Sustainability and the Environment and 5 papers in Materials Chemistry. Recurrent topics in Adriana Barylyak's work include Laser-Ablation Synthesis of Nanoparticles (5 papers), Bone Tissue Engineering Materials (4 papers) and TiO2 Photocatalysis and Solar Cells (4 papers). Adriana Barylyak is often cited by papers focused on Laser-Ablation Synthesis of Nanoparticles (5 papers), Bone Tissue Engineering Materials (4 papers) and TiO2 Photocatalysis and Solar Cells (4 papers). Adriana Barylyak collaborates with scholars based in Ukraine, Poland and Germany. Adriana Barylyak's co-authors include Yaroslav Bobitski, Małgorzata Kus‐Liśkiewicz, Andreas Bund, Svetlozar Ivanov, Andrzej Dziedzic, Bartosz Skóra, Іryna Yaremchuk, Urszula Krajewska, Renata Wojnarowska‐Nowak and Anna Nowak and has published in prestigious journals such as Journal of Power Sources, Scientific Reports and International Journal of Molecular Sciences.
